  • Vehicle dynamics is the Dynamics of Vehicles, here assumed to be ground vehicles.

(For the dynamics of air vehicles see Aerodynamics.)

It is a part of engineering primarily based on classical mechanics but it may also involve chemistry solid state physics, electrical engineering, communications, psychology etc.
